> >> Is your mail server set to "no mail relay"?  If it is, you need the
> > outlook
> >> client to authenticate to the server.  In outlook go to your 
> >> properties
> > and
> >> make sure that "my outgoing server requires 
> authentication" and this
> > should
> >> fix it.  Or you can set your mail server to relay mail for 
> addresses 
> >> but
> >> I
> >> don't recommend that.
> >
> > Why not relay for addresses?  That is a perfectly legit way 
> to setup 
> > IMail relaying for trusted IP address ranges.  There are not open 
> > relay concerns with this, unless you inadvertently include 
> a spammers 
> > IP address in your relay configuration.
